Greg returns to Vancouver Island after the 30 Day Survival Challenge with ‪@amosrodriguezsurvival‬ to search for his camera and the important footage it contains. He revisits the challenge locations and finds more adventures along the way, catching salmon, overnight hammock (stealth) camping, spotting wildlife, gold panning, relaxing with old friends, and more!
Greg is a self-taught survivalist from Canal Flats, British Colombia, who, since he was a boy, has read nearly every book on the topic. When he is not out in the wilderness, he is a professional dry-waller. He started his first bow drill fire when he was thirteen and spent the next forty years learning bushcraft and studying plants and edibles. He has even developed some of his own survival techniques and is a skilled hunter with both a bow and a slingshot.

Wow. we have a native larch, my dad's family here in Maine calls them hackmatack, Abenaki for snow shoe trees.(tamarack in Algonquin, also meaning snow shoe trees). I've frequently described the nice young red cones to people. One fall many years ago, I camped at a site that had tree plantings. I thought they were hackmatacks at a glance but looking back at my memories, the cones looked closer to yew.. I wonder now... They did look more like the inverted smooth drop shaped cupped cones you are showing us here. Hackmatack cones are a very similar, red but not cupped and more differentiated, as a close cluster of petals. Thanks Greg. Really enjoying your channel but I want you to watch me cast a fishing rod.
